Grey Evaluation Model of Students' Teaching Experiment Grades

The paper discusses the significance of training new military personnel to accelerate the development of navy weapon and equipment system. In order to cultivate more new military personnel, it is an important part to enhance the teaching quality in practical process. Meanwhile, to effectively evaluate students' learning effect in practical process is also the important measure to cultivate personnel with innovation spirit. In accordance with the synthetic evaluation problem of students' experiment performance, taking into account various factors that influence experiment grades, avoiding many disadvantages brought about from the conventional examination, we established the evaluation system, and carried out synthetic evaluation of studentspsila experiment grades by adopting the "grey system theory", establishing the "grey evaluation model", and programming with MATLAB. The grey evaluation model followed the following steps: At first, the evaluation index is defined. Secondly, the weight vectors are determined. Thirdly, evaluation sample matrix is formed. Fourthly, the gray categories of evaluation are determined and the grey evaluation modulus is calculated. In the final stage, overall evaluation value are calculated and put in sequence. A case study in Dalian Naval Academy is provided to demonstrate the application of this method. The finding clearly indicates that the grey evaluation model may successfully evaluated students' comprehensive learning capacity.
